Accidental shooting in Mecosta County leaves 16-year-old girl injured

SHERIDEN TOWNSHIP — The Mecosta County Sheriff’s Office is investigating an accidental shooting in Sheriden Township.

Deputies were called to a home near Harding Road and 55th Avenue around 10 p.m. Saturday night where they found a 16-year-old girl has been shot in the neck.

Deputies performed CPR until paramedics arrived, where she was transferred to Big Rapids hospital and later taken to Butterworth Hospital in Grand Rapids.

After conducting an investigation that included witnesses, it was determined that a 21-year-old man from Barryton accidentally shot her.

The Sheriff’s Office is reminding everyone to handle all firearms as if they’re loaded and to practice proper gun safety at all times.

The 16-year-old girl, whose name is not being released, is expected to survive.
